30V/1A PFM/PWM Synchronous Buck Regulator

Description:
The MCP16311/2 is a compact, high-efficiency, fixed frequency, synchronous step down DC-DC converter in an 8-pin MSOP, or 2 x 3 mm TDFN package that operates from input voltage sources up to 30V. Integrated features include a high-side and a low-side switch, fixed frequency peak current mode control, internal compensation, peak current limit and overtemperature protection. The MCP16311/2 provides all the active functions for local DC-DC conversion, with fast transient response and accurate regulation. High converter efficiency is achieved by integrating the current-limited, low-resistance, high-speed high-side and low-side switches and associated drive circuitry. The MCP16311 is capable of running in PWM/PFM mode. It switches in PFM mode for light load conditions and for large buck conversion ratios. This results in a higher efficiency over all load ranges. The MCP16312 runs in PWM-only mode, and is recommended for noise-sensitive applications. The MCP16311/2 can supply up to 1A of continuous current while regulating the output voltage from 2V to 12V. An integrated, high-performance peak current mode architecture keeps the output voltage tightly regulated, even during input voltage steps and output current transient conditions common in power systems. The EN input is used to turn the device on and off. While off, only a few micro amps of current are consumed from the input. Output voltage is set with an external resistor divider. The MCP16311/2 is offered in small MSOP-8 and 2 x 3 mm TDFN surface mount packages.

Features:
- Up to 95% Efficiency
- Input Voltage Range: 4.4V to 30V
- 1A Output Current Capability
- Output Voltage Range: 2.0V to 24V
- Qualification: AEC-Q100 Rev. G, Grade 1 (-40°C to +125°C)
- Integrated N-Channel High-Side and Low-Side Switches:
- 170mOhm, Low Side
- 300mOhm, High Side
- Stable Reference Voltage: 0.8V
- Automatic Pulse Frequency Modulation/Pulse-Width Modulation (PFM/PWM) Operation (MCP16311):
- PFM Operation Disabled (MCP16312)
- PWM Operation: 500 kHz
- Low Device Shutdown Current: 3 µA Typical
- Low Device Quiescent Current: - 44 µA (Non-switching, PFM Mode)
- Internal Compensation
- Internal Soft-Start: 300 µs (EN Low-to-High)
- Peak Current Mode Control
- Cycle-by-Cycle Peak Current Limit
- Undervoltage Lockout (UVLO):
- 4.1V typical to start
- 3.6V typical to stop
- Overtemperature Protection
- Thermal Shutdown:
- +150°C
- +25°C Hysteresis
